I just had a back up system installed last week. Sensor (drill in type) - $60 Paint Match - $100 (I got it done for less, cuz I know the autobody guy, but he said it would be around $100 for other folk) Install - $80 Total cost = $240 Most sponsors could not match that (on RS or bcmazda3). Got it done by a guy named John. PM me for phone#. The install was very clean, can't tell where the wire is unless you really look. The guy says he's been doing it for 10+ years (i exercised professional skepticism ;)) and does install for dealerships. Overall he seems to know wtf he's doing. The only issue I had was, my A-pillar cover was lose, going this weekend to get it fixed. Unit comes with 1yr warranty. |
